I haven't had an exacerbation since last December and for me, that's a real milestone.
This past week, however, I've been going downhill. It all started on Monday when I worked on a landscape job in the 97 degree heat (yeah yeah I know). By Tuesday afternoon, I was feeling better and thought maybe I had my usual Uthoff's Syndrome symptoms and was over it. By Thursday, I was still doing the denial thing. Well, by last night I can no longer do the denial dance. My right leg is definitely giving me fits and I can hardly touch it and now my left arm is doing the same thing. Today, my right hand is almost numb and I cannot bend my right thumb. I hate this. Fatigue is kicking my butt, but it usually does this time of year because of the heat, but it hasn't been hot since Monday. I am in this clinical trial and I know that I cannot do steroids ... except once during the whole trial, so I am kind of up a creek here. I just don't know what to do...but I know that I need to call my neuro next week if this keeps up. ![]()
